关于java中char数组的调用

---恢复内容开始---

char数组在初始化时,元素需要用单引号引起来。调用时只写数组名就可以

 

class   ToString
{
	public static void main(String[] args) 
	{
		char[] a ={'a','d','f','f'};
		String sam=toString(char a);
		System.out.println(sam);
	}
	public static String toString(char [] sum){
		String sam="";
		for(int x=0;x<sum.length;x++){
			sam=sam+sum[x];
		}
		return sam;
	}
}

  上面错误在于 String sam=toString(char a);

正确的调用方法事 String sam=toString(a);

引以为戒。

---恢复内容结束---

posted on 2015-05-18 10:01  Goorwl  阅读(3742)  评论(0编辑  收藏  举报